Part of the growing craft beer scene in St. Louis, Six Row opened in October last year and has quickly grown to be one of the most prominent brewpubs in town, with local food magazine Sauce even calling their whiskey barrel porter an instant \u201cgotta-have-it beer.\u201d We managed to get our hands on that whiskey-barrel porter and can back up Sauce’s big talk; it’s very smooth and chalked full of whiskey flavor while clocking in at an easy drinking 6% ABV.<\/p>\n

Named for both the six people involved in created the brewery and the sixrow style of malt used in brewing, Six Row distributes around St. Louis and in the Metro East area of Illinois, and can even be found as far north as Effingham – but for one night only, the beer, the brewer and one of the owners will be north of 80.<\/p>\n
